The length of a tangent from a point A at a distance 5
cms. from the centre of the circle is 4 cms. Radius of the circle isSolution
A tangent at any point of a circle is perpendicular to the radius through the point of contact. Therefore, ∠OTA = 90° and ΔOTA is a right-angled triangle. By Pythagoras theorem, OA2 = OT2 + AT2 52 = OT2 + 42 OT2 = 25 - 16 OT2 = 9 OT = ± 3 Radius OT cannot be negative. Hence, the radius is 3 cm.
